test_that("Parser constructor", {
library(redland)
world <- new("World")
expect_false(is.null(world))
# Test creating the Storage system
storage <- new("Storage", world, "hashes", name="", options="hash-type='memory'")
expect_false(is.null(storage))
expect_match(class(storage@librdf_storage), "_p_librdf_storage_s")
# Test creating the Model
model <- new("Model", world, storage, options="")
expect_false(is.null(model))
expect_match(class(model@librdf_model), "_p_librdf_model_s")
# Test that model creation fails if world is not provided or is null
err <- try(model <- new("Model", world=NULL, storage, options=""), silent=TRUE)
expect_match(class(err), "try-error")
expect_false(is.null(model))
expect_match(class(model@librdf_model), "_p_librdf_model_s")
# Test parsing an RDF document into a Model
parser <- new("Parser", world)
expect_false(is.null(parser))
expect_match(class(parser@librdf_parser), "_p_librdf_parser_s")
parseFileIntoModel(parser, world, system.file('extdata/example.rdf', package='redland'), model)
# Test creating a Serializer and serializing the content just parsed into the model
serializer <- new("Serializer", world)
expect_false(is.null(serializer))
expect_match(class(serializer@librdf_serializer), "_p_librdf_serializer_s")
# Test performing a serialization on an RDF model
rdf <- serializeToCharacter(serializer, world, model)
expect_match(rdf, "John Smith")
err <- try(freeModel(model), silent=TRUE)
expect_false(class(err) == "try-error")
err <- try(freeStorage(storage), silent=TRUE)
expect_false(class(err) == "try-error")
err <- try(freeParser(parser), silent=TRUE)
expect_false(class(err) == "try-error")
err <- try(freeSerializer(serializer), silent=TRUE)
expect_false(class(err) == "try-error")
err <- try(freeWorld(world), silent=TRUE)
expect_false(class(err) == "try-error")
})
